In this exclusive video, we talk to one of the greatest soccer players of all time, Mia Hamm. As a player, Mia inspired millions of female athletes, she's won Olympic Gold Medals, World Championships, and was twice voted FIFA's Player of the Year. In this interview she tells us what it was like being the youngest player in history to join the USA National Team, and around 2:05 in the video find out what would she would do if she was not a soccer star.
